Ports of Dampier, Ashburton, Cape Preston West and Varanus Island resume operations.
Tropical Cyclone Mitchell
08:00 AWST 9/02/2026
As at 08:00 AWST, Monday 9 February 2026, Pilbara Ports will resume operations at the Ports of Dampier, Ashburton, Cape Preston West and Varanus Island.
No further updates will be provided for all ports, but individual terminal operators should liaise directly with the Harbour Master.

As per the Port Authorities Act 1999 (WA), Pilbara Ports is required to establish a Community Consultation Committee for each port under its control. The purpose of these committees is to facilitate information sharing and consultation between the port authority and the local community.
The Port of Dampier Community Consultation Committee (DCCC) was established in June 2015. Meetings are held three times a year.
Membership of the DCCC includes representation from the City of Karratha, KDCCI, Dampier Community Association, Karratha Community Association, Murujuga Aboriginal Corporation, Dampier Seafarers, King Bay Game Fishing Club, Nickol Bay Fishing Club, Karratha Visitors Centre and local community members.
